Imagine that time to complete almost all tickets is 4 hours. But one of those tickets will have an unforeseen problem, increasing the time by -4 hours (instant solve) to a year. The outlier now dominates the schedule. (my summary of:
https://erikbern.com/2019/04/15/why-software-projects-take-longer-than-you-think-a-statistical-model.html
